#1c144d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1c144d is composed of 11% red, 7.8% green and 30.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 63.6% cyan, 74% magenta, 0% yellow and 69.8% black. It has a hue angle of 248.4 degrees, a saturation of 58.8% and a lightness of 19%. #1c144d color hex could be obtained by blending #38289a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#1c144d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1c144d has RGB values of R:28, G:20, B:77 and CMYK values of C:0.64, M:0.74, Y:0, K:0.7. Its decimal value is 1840205.

Shades and Tints of #1c144d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#05040f is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1c144d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2f2e33 is the less saturated color, while #0f0160 is the most saturated one.
